on my right thigh just in my groin area close to my family jewls I checked to see how things looked because i had some sore spots there and i saw a patch of skin that had been worn off and red the size of a quarter.. im like Holy s***! I immediately postponed my plans to clean, slathered up w Calmoseptine and aired the crap out of it.. good news is that while its hard to tell with the rash cream still on down there it seems to have cleared up quite a bit. THANK GOD for calmoseptine. Actualy use calmoseptine along with the gerenic Walgreens brand. Both are similar, except the walgreens is not as thick and easier to spread. But it is just as soothing. Methinks ill stock up on the gereric stuff since its cheaper and works awesome.. and its cheaper too!

I have discovered the hard way that when mowing the yard of doing something that involved excessive sweating I would rub the inner thighs almost raw. Now I rub a lot of petroleum jelly between my thighs and that has helped. Word of caution though is dont handle your diaper tab after doing that.
